Why Pricing is Omitted and Why It’s a Problem

In the world of cosmetic surgery, clinics often avoid listing fixed prices for several reasons:

  • Customized Procedures: Each rhinoplasty case is unique, depending on the patient’s anatomy, desired outcome, and the specific techniques required. A standard price might not reflect the true cost for every individual.
  • Consultation-Based Pricing: Many surgeons prefer to offer a detailed quote only after a thorough consultation, where they can assess the patient’s needs, discuss expectations, and explain the surgical plan.
  • Competitive Reasons: Some clinics might avoid publishing prices to prevent competitors from undercutting them or to maintain flexibility in their pricing strategy.
  • Ancillary Costs: The total cost often includes not just the surgeon’s fee but also anesthesia fees, facility fees, post-operative care, and follow-up appointments. These can vary.

However, from a consumer’s perspective, this lack of transparency is problematic:

  • Budgeting Difficulties: Without any indication of cost, potential patients cannot budget or determine if the service is within their financial reach. This often means investing time in a consultation only to discover the price is prohibitive.
  • Information Asymmetry: The power dynamic is shifted, with the clinic holding all the information until the consultation, which can feel like a high-pressure sales environment for some.
  • Trust Issues: For a medical procedure, particularly one considered ethically questionable in many contexts, the absence of basic financial transparency can erode trust. Altering Allah’s Creation

The foundational principle in Islam is that Allah SWT is the best of creators, and His creation is perfect in its design. Nc-investments.com Review

Deliberately altering one’s physical features without a genuine medical necessity e.g., correcting a deformity, injury, or severe functional impairment is often viewed as interfering with Allah’s creation.

  • Verse from Quran: The Quran mentions Shaytan Satan vowing to “order them to change the nature of Allah’s creation” Quran 4:119. Scholars interpret this verse as a prohibition against altering one’s body for vanity, indicating a disobedience to Allah’s command and an alignment with Shaytan’s whisperings.
  • Hadith on Changing Appearance: There are numerous prophetic traditions Hadith that strongly condemn practices like tattooing, plucking eyebrows, and filing teeth for beauty, which are considered attempts to alter Allah’s creation. By analogy, many contemporary scholars extend this prohibition to cosmetic surgeries like rhinoplasty when done purely for aesthetic enhancement.
  • Distinction Between Cosmetic and Reconstructive: A critical distinction is made between purely cosmetic surgery and reconstructive surgery. If a person has a genuine physical defect e.g., a birth defect, a disfigurement from an accident, or a severe breathing issue due to nasal structure that causes physical harm or significant psychological distress not mere dissatisfaction with appearance, then surgery to correct it is generally permissible. However, changing a normal, healthy nose simply because one dislikes its appearance is considered impermissible.
